Some 300,000 Austrian subjects died; the overwhelming majority of these were … WebAbout 8 million people lost their lives during the Russian Civil War. About one million were soldiers of the Red Army. The anti-communists and the White Army killed at least 50,000 communists. Many millions of people also died due to famine, starvation and epidemics.
